Official DOL plan name: Benchmark Senior Living 401(k) Plan · Sponsored by Benchmark Senior Living LLC · Massachusetts · Healthcare & Social Assistance

$95M in assets, 6,822 participants

Benchmark Senior Living LLC's Benchmark Senior Living 401(k) Plan reported $95M in total assets and 6,822 particip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 90th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

What changed between DOL Form 5500 filings

plan year 2023 → plan year 2024

  • Benchmark Senior Living 401(k) Plan end-of-year assets rose from $82M in the plan year 2023 filing to $95M in the plan year 2024 filing.
  • Benchmark Senior Living 401(k) Plan reported participants rose from 6,315 in the plan year 2023 filing to 6,822 in the plan year 2024 filing.
  • Benchmark Senior Living 401(k) Plan reported net income fell from $14M in the plan year 2023 filing to $13M in the plan year 2024 filing.

Scale composition for Benchmark Senior Living 401(k) Plan

Benchmark Senior Living 401(k) Plan reports $95M in end-of-year assets across 6,822 participants (0.001% of the $12.3T held by all Form 5500 filers in the national rollup , and 0.007% of 93,925,755 covered participants) - about $13,925 per participant (10% of the national average assets-per-participant) . Net income for plan year 2024 was $13M.

This plan identity (EIN 043385173, plan #001) has 3 Form 5500 filings on file from 2022 to 2024 , with end-of-year assets moving from $68M to $95M (+39.6%) while covered participants moved from 5,931 to 6,822 . Single-year sparse filers cannot show that trail.
